Meatloaf Recipe


Meatloaf Recipe
This is a spicier version of grandma's bland meatloaf. My friends couldn't figure out what made it so good!

Ingredients
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 4 slices sandwich bread torn into pieces
  • 3 pounds ground sirloin
  • 2 small onions, finely chopped
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1/2 cup favorite barbecue sauce, plus 1/4 cup for glaze
  • 1 tablespoon parsley
  • 1/2 cup grated jalepeno cheese
  • 2 large eggs, lightly beaten
  • salt and pepper

Directions
  1. Preheat oven to 350, with rack in center.
  2. In a large bowl, pour milk over bread and let soak about 30 seconds.
  3. Add sirloin, onion, garlic, 1/2 cup barbecue sauce, parsley, jalepeno cheese, eggs, salt and pepper. Using your hands, mix until combined; do not overmix or meatloaf will be too dense. Divide mixture in half.
  4. Gently pat each half in a log and place each in an 8 1/2 by 4 1/2-inch loaf pan. Do not press down of into corners of pan.
  5. Bake 50 minutes. Brush tops of loaves with remaining 1/4 cup barbecue sauce; continue cooking untill juices run clear and meat thermometer reads 160 degrees F, about 10 minutes.
  6. Remove from oven; let stand 5 minutes. Turn loaves out of and serve.
